Activities & Mission

To advance education for the public benefit in the history and heritage of the the Village of Wye and the former Wye College by the establishment and maintenance of a museum and by other means as the charity trustees shall think fit.

Frequently asked questions about Wye Heritage

What does Wye Heritage do?

To advance education for the public benefit in the history and heritage of the the Village of Wye and the former Wye College by the establishment and maintenance of a museum and by other means as the charity trustees shall think fit.

How much income did Wye Heritage report in 2025?

Wye Heritage reported total income of £30k and reported expenditure of £4k for the financial year ending 2025, based on the most recent annual return filed with the Charity Commission.

When was Wye Heritage registered as a charity?

Wye Heritage was registered with the Charity Commission for England and Wales on 17 February 2021 as charity number 1193580. It has been registered for 5 years.

Who runs Wye Heritage?

Wye Heritage is governed by a board of 10 trustees. Trustees are legally responsible for the charity's governance and are listed in full on its profile.

Where does Wye Heritage operate?

Wye Heritage operates in Kent, as recorded in its Charity Commission filing.

Is Wye Heritage a registered charity?

Yes — Wye Heritage is a registered charity in England and Wales, charity number 1193580.
